An unaccompanied migrant child is someone who is: under the age of 18 years old; has no legal status, and; has no parent or legal guardian in the United States or the parent or legal guardian is unavailable to provide physical custody or care.USCRIs shelter for unaccompanied migrant girls, Rinconcito del Sol, called a model government-funded shelter,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S).. The BronxWorks Comprehensive Services for Immigrant Families Program provides services to recent immigrant families residing in Community District 4, specifically in zip codes 10452 or 10456.The program assists with connection to services such as English classes, housing assistance, legal immigration services, childcare, and medical care. The South Texas Pro Bono Asylum Representation Project (ProBAR) is a project of the American Bar Association that provides legal information, pro se assistance and pro bono representation to thousands of immigrants and asylum-seekers in remote South Texas each year.
